@@ -0,0 +1,232 @@
+================================================================================
+ Board Information
+================================================================================
+
+Developed by HiSilicon, the board features the Hi3798C V200 with an
+integrated quad-core 64-bit ARM Cortex A53 processor and high
+performance Mali T720 GPU, making it capable of running any commercial
+set-top solution based on Linux or Android. Its high performance
+specification also supports a premium user experience with up to H.265
+HEVC decoding of 4K video at 60 frames per second.
+
+SOC Hisilicon Hi3798CV200
+CPU Quad-core ARM Cortex-A53 64 bit
+DRAM DDR3/3L/4 SDRAM interface, maximum 32-bit data width 2 GB
+USB Two USB 2.0 ports One USB 3.0 ports
+CONSOLE USB-micro port for console support
+ETHERNET 1 GBe Ethernet
+PCIE One PCIe 2.0 interfaces
+JTAG 8-Pin JTAG
+EXPANSION INTERFACE Linaro 96Boards Low Speed Expansion slot
+DIMENSION Standard 160×120 mm 96Boards Enterprice Edition form factor
+WIFI 802.11AC 2*2 with Bluetooth
+CONNECTORS One connector for Smart Card One connector for TSI

+================================================================================
+ BUILD INSTRUCTIONS
+================================================================================
+
+Compile from source:
+====================
+
+Get all the sources
+
+ > mkdir -p ~/poplar/src ~/poplar/bin
+ > cd ~/poplar/src
+ > git clone ssh://git at dev-private-git.linaro.org/aspen/staging/l-loader.git l-loader
+ > git clone ssh://git at dev-private-git.linaro.org/aspen/staging/arm-trusted-firmware.git atf
+ > git clone ssh://git at dev-private-git.linaro.org/aspen/staging/u-boot.git u-boot
+ > git clone ssh://git at dev-private-git.linaro.org/aspen/tools.git
+
+Compile U-Boot:
+===============
+
+ Prerequisite:
+ # sudo apt-get install device-tree-compiler
+
+ > cd ~/poplar/src/u-boot
+ > make CROSS_COMPILE=aarch64-linux-gnu- poplar_defconfig
+ > make CROSS_COMPILE=aarch64-linux-gnu-
+ > cp u-boot.bin ~/poplar/bin
+
+Compile ARM Trusted Firmware (ATF):
+===================================
+
+ > cd ~/poplar/src/atf
+ > make CROSS_COMPILE=aarch64-linux-gnu- all fip \
+ SPD=none BL33=~/poplar/bin/u-boot.bin DEBUG=1 PLAT=hi3798cv200
+
+Copy resulting binaries
+ > cp build/hi3798cv200/debug/bl1.bin ~/poplar/src/l-loader/atf/
+ > cp build/hi3798cv200/debug/fip.bin ~/poplar/src/l-loader/atf/
+
+Compile l-loader:
+=================
+
+ > cd ~/poplar/src/l-loader
+ > make clean
+ > make CROSS_COMPILE=arm-linux-gnueabi-
+
+ Due to BootROM requiremets, rename l-loader.bin to fastboot.bin:
+ > cp l-loader.bin ~/poplar/bin/fastboot.bin
+
+
+================================================================================
+ FLASH INSTRUCTIONS
+================================================================================
+
+Two methods:
+
+Using USB debrick support:
+ Copy fastboot.bin to a FAT partition on the USB drive and reboot the
+ poplar board while pressing S3(usb_boot).
+
+ The system will execute the new u-boot and boot into a shell which you
+ can then use to write to eMMC.
+
+Using U-BOOT from shell:
+ 1) using AXIS usb ethernet dongle and tftp
+ 2) using FAT formated USB drive

On 05/05/2017 07:55 PM, Jorge Ramirez wrote:
> On 05/05/2017 05:34 PM, Marek Vasut wrote:
>> On 05/05/2017 04:32 PM, Tom Rini wrote:
>>> On Thu, May 04, 2017 at 03:47:07PM +0200, Jorge Ramirez-Ortiz wrote:
>>>
>>> CC'ing Marek...
>>>
>>>> Signed-off-by: Jorge Ramirez-Ortiz <jorge.ramirez-ortiz@linaro.org>
>>>> ---
>>>> .../arm/include/asm/arch-hi3798cv200/hi3798cv200.h | 93 ++++++++++
>>>> drivers/usb/host/Kconfig | 6 +
>>>> drivers/usb/host/Makefile | 1 +
>>>> drivers/usb/host/ehci-hi3798cv200.c | 196
>>>> +++++++++++++++++++++
>>>> 4 files changed, 296 insertions(+)
>>>> create mode 100644
>>>> arch/arm/include/asm/arch-hi3798cv200/hi3798cv200.h
>>>> create mode 100644 drivers/usb/host/ehci-hi3798cv200.c
>>>>
>>>> diff --git a/arch/arm/include/asm/arch-hi3798cv200/hi3798cv200.h
>>>> b/arch/arm/include/asm/arch-hi3798cv200/hi3798cv200.h
>>>> new file mode 100644
>>>> index 0000000..c67fda1
>>>> --- /dev/null
>>>> +++ b/arch/arm/include/asm/arch-hi3798cv200/hi3798cv200.h
>>>> @@ -0,0 +1,93 @@
>>>> +/*
>>>> + * (C) Copyright 2017 Linaro
>>>> + * Jorge Ramirez-Ortiz <jorge.ramirez-ortiz@linaro.org>
>>>> + *
>>>> + * S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0+
>>>> + */
>>>> +
>>>> +#ifndef __HI3798cv200_H__
>>>> +#define __HI3798cv200_H__
>> This should be a separate patch ..
> hi Marek
>
> to be clear, are you asking a single patch containing hi3798cv200.h?
Yes, this is arch stuff and is not in any way part of the USB driver IMO.
